Default Special Forces Review?

I was holding off on buying the Special Forces expansion until I saw some substantive reviews, but such reviews have either been extremely sparse or so vague that they were not convincing or clearly conclusive. On a scale of 0 to 10 (0 being "Road to Rome", and 10 being very good) where does the expansion lay, and what is/are the reason(s) for your score?

I have it. I like it. The addition of night vision (and maps to use it in) is great. Also, the tear gas and masks add an additional element to the support role. I paid $25 for it and the new maps alone are worth that.

*Edit*
I'll give it a 7 for the maps and new functionality.
